The 2-LP Elvis Presley "Live At The International Hotel" set is significant as it reportedly includes the entire August 23, 1969 dinner show, which is--hold onto your hats--previously unreleased. As in literally not a single second of this particular show has NEVER BEEN RELEASED IN ANY FORM, ANYWHERE IN THE WORLD. Not on an import, not on an FTD title--never, nowhere, not at all.
Twelve concerts were recorded to multitrack tape over the course of a week from this, Presley's first (and best) post-army Vegas stand, and this was the only show out of those twelve to remain entirely in the vault.
The LP set reportedly contains a download code.
Finally, all of this 1969 live/multitrack material seems destined for release later this year as a boxed set.
Elvis is dead, people. This may be the last time it will be possible to tout the release of a truly previously unreleased (and unbootlegged) Presley concert from multitrack tapes.
